Your broker offers to sell you some shares of Bahnsen & Co. common stock that paid a dividend of $2.50 yesterday. Bahnsen's dividend is expected to grow at 8% per year for the next 3 years. If you buy the stock, you plan to hold it for 3 years and then sell it. The appropriate discount rate is 12%.

  1. Find the expected dividend for each of the next 3 years; that is, calculate D1, D2, and D3. Note that D0 = $2.50. Do not round intermediate calculations. Round your answers to the nearest cent. D1 = $ D2 = $ D3 = $
  2. Given that the first dividend payment will occur 1 year from now, find the present value of the dividend stream; that is, calculate the PVs of D1, D2, and D3, and then sum these PVs. Do not round intermediate calculations. Round your answer to the nearest cent. $
  3. You expect the price of the stock 3 years from now to be $85.03; that is, you expect to equal $85.03. Discounted at a 12% rate, what is the present value of this expected future stock price? In other words, calculate the PV of $85.03. Do not round intermediate calculations. Round your answer to the nearest cent. $
  4. If you plan to buy the stock, hold it for 3 years, and then sell it for $85.03, what is the most you should pay for it today? Do not round intermediate calculations. Round your answer to the nearest cent. $
  5. Use equation below to calculate the present value of this stock. Assume that g = 8% and that it is constant. Do not round intermediate calculations. Round your answer to the nearest cent. $
